Thermistors are mainly used in temperature measurement, temperature control, temperature compensation, automatic gain adjustment dispatching, microwave power measurement, fire alarm, infrared detection and voltage stabilization, and amplitude stabilization. They are the required components in active containment facilities. According to the consistency of resistance temperature coefficient, it is divided into positive temperature coefficient and negative temperature coefficient.
In the task temperature category, the resistance of the positive temperature coefficient increases sharply as the temperature rises, and the resistance of the negative temperature coefficien decreases sharply as the temperature rises. The latter applications are more widespread. Because the thermistor has a thermosensitive property, its voltage and current no longer maintain a linear relationship and become a non-linear element.
